Rice ABI5-Like1 Regulates Abscisic Acid and Auxin Responses by Affecting the Expression of ABRE-Containing Genes    

Abstract: Abscisic acid (ABA) regulates plant development and is crucial for plant responses to biotic and abiotic stresses. Studies have identified the key components of ABA signaling in Arabidopsis (Arabidopsis thaliana), some of which regulate ABA responses by the transcriptional regulation of downstream genes. Here, we report the functional identification of rice (Oryza sativa) ABI5-Like1 (ABL1), which is a basic region/leucine zipper motif transcription factor. “…Based on the observation that OsPM19L1 was dramatically induced by ABA treatment, it may play an important role in ABA signaling. The ABL1 protein is localized to the nucleus and modulates the plant stress and ABA responses by directly regulating the ABRE-containing genes (Yang et al, 2011). An ABRE protein binding site in the promoter region of OsPM19L1 suggests that OsPM19L1 may participate in plant stress and ABA responses under the regulation of ABL1 transcription factor.…”

“…Yang et al (2011) have shown that rice ABI5-Like1 (ABL1) regulates ABA and auxin responses through ABRe-containing wRKY genes. OsWRKY69 has an ABRe element in its promoter that leads to specific binding of the bZIP transcription factor (ABL1), which suppresses auxin signaling while enhancing ABA signaling and hence provides insights into ABA and auxin crosstalk ).…”
